pas·time

noun

pastime (noun) · pastimes (plural noun)

  - an activity that someone does regularly for enjoyment rather than work; a hobby:

Synonyms

hobby, sport, game, recreation, amusement, avocation, diversion, divertissement, distraction, relaxation, pleasure, entertainment, fun, interest, sideline, enthusiasm, passion, fad, craze, mania, obsession, bug, thing
